Ms Yeo belongs to Singapore’s lump ranks of «singles» – an expression employed by statistics gatherers so you’re able to define anyone who has never ever hitched – that happen to be old thirty five and you can earlier.

Within the 2004, there are 844,100 Singapore customers who had been single people, than the step 1,048,100 a year ago – a bounce off nearly twenty-five percent over ten years, rates on the Institution off Analytics reveal.

What number of single men and women in addition to flower all over all ages interviewed, nevertheless sharpest surge was a student in brand new 50s generation. The quantity flower of 43,100 in order to 75,600 ranging from 2004 and you can 2014 – or a bounce out-of 75 percent.

In a sense, these number commonly alarming since the e development: people are marriage after – or otherwise not anyway.

By the all membership, relationship people shall be strong inside the Singapore to your growth of dating and you may dating software particularly Tinder

Delaying wedding try reflective of all developed places, states member professor Paulin Straughan, a great sociologist from the Federal College or university from Singapore (NUS).

The main reason to possess postponing wedding is actually «contending lifetime needs», she claims, such a prolonged months inside specialized studies and you can community.

New median ages to own very first-big date grooms for the Singapore rose out of 29.step one ages inside the 2003 to help you 31.a couple of years within the 2013. To have brides, they flower out of twenty-six.6 many years so you can twenty-eight.step one decades.

Also, bbwcupid apk dating organizations in Singapore have also seen a rise in demand off elderly american singles – and additionally notice out of divorcees and you may widows.

CompleteMe, an online dating agencies with an effective 3,000-solid database, install a good customised relationships services having a lot more than-35s just last year who has as seen a beneficial forty per cent boost in consumers.

Ms Anisa Hassan, dealing with director off It’s simply Lunch China, and therefore matchmakes benefits over a dessert, says: «In past times, people that was basically partnered prior to may have believed that an informed age is actually behind them. Today, a lot more separated persons attended give.»

Within the 2004, if the providers already been, 20 per cent of the clients was basically divorced or widowed. Now, 40 % try divorced and you may 10 % are widowed.
